Nice speakers, but when mounting it on the door panel you will probably get excess vibration. I had Kappas a while back in my Golf and loved them. They were virtually impossible to blow. They do require more juice to drive as they are somewhat inefficient. However, what they loose in inefficiency, they make up in robustness. Clarity and presence wasn't too bad either.
